Role Summary:

The main function of a Support Analyst is to perform a wide variety of installation, configuration and upgrading of servers and related hardware and software in a LAN, WAN and stand-alone environment, providing investigation, diagnostic testing and repair/resolution of system, hardware, software and infrastructure.



Job Responsibilities:

Complete configuration, installation and support of equipment to the specifications of the business
Maintain software applications and operating systems through regular maintenance
Maintain configuration and support documentation
Manage assigned projects and program components to deliver services in accordance with established objectives
Supervise the administration of systems and servers to ensure availability of services to authorized users
Maintain multi-site network operations, software applications, operating systems through regular maintenance
Troubleshoot malfunctions of hardware, software applications and security systems to resolve operational issues and restore services
